Be very carefull when putting used manifolds on, Its very hard to know exactly what kind of shape they are inside. The walls could be very thin and close to failure, thereby letting water seep into the cylinders when you shut down. Raw water manifolds usually last about 5-7 yrs depending on use. I know its expensive for new ones, but you might ruin your motor by putting a cheap used one on. Just something to ponder
